Taxonomic history

First described as
Poecilodryas? sigillata
Described by
(De Vis, CW, 1890)
Type locality
Mt. Victoria, southeastern New Guinea.
Original description
Annual Report on British New Guinea from 4th September, 1888 to 30th June 1889 with Map and Appendices App.G p.59
